Statement by Statoil Re: Human rights advisor sues Norwegian oil company over false representations about its commitment to respecting human rights

Statoil ASA has been made aware that an employee...has filed a lawsuit against Statoil ASA in California, U.S... Statoil ASA rejects...allegations [made in the lawsuit] as unfounded and incorrect. As this an ongoing lawsuit, Statoil will not provide further comments to the press release. As an international oil and gas company, Statoil takes its human rights responsibilities very seriously. Statoil ASA is a founding member of the UN Global Compact, an active supporter of international initiatives on business and human rights, and works systematically to ensure that its operations meet all applicable national and international laws and standards.
